If you want to know how to start government contracting without past performance or capital, this episode breaks down a powerful consulting-first strategy that can fast-track your entry into GovCon. Instead of struggling to win contracts from scratch, you'll learn how to partner with established businesses and leverage their existing capabilities to unlock opportunities.
In this episode, we explore why most business owners are stuck working in their business instead of growing it—and how that creates a massive opportunity for you. By stepping in as a consultant, you can help these companies expand into federal contracting while positioning yourself for bigger deals, partnerships, and even acquisitions.
Key takeaways include:
Why consulting is the fastest way to break into government contracting
How to find and partner with established businesses lacking GovCon expertise
The long-term opportunity of scaling companies for contracts and potential exits
This episode also dives into the shifting landscape of small business programs and why building capacity now is more important than ever.
